People In Harmony With Nature: SANParks Hosts Transformative Vision 2040 Indaba
Following extensive consultations which resulted in the drafting of a strategic framework that will inform implementation, South African National Parks (SANParks) is now proud to announce the inaugural Vision 2040 Indaba, which will take place at Running Waters in Gqeberha from 3 to 5 September 2025. This landmark event marks a pivotal moment that is designed to realise a co-owned inclusive, future-oriented and transformative conservation agenda.
The Vision 2040 Indaba will bring together key stakeholders across government, farming communities, academia, civil society, sponsors, donors, the private sector, land claimant communities, conservation partners and youth representatives. The Indaba is intended to foster meaningful dialogue and forge collaborative actions that will advance the implementation of Vision 2040 – a bold strategy that advocates for a people-centred, conservation-driven agenda that will ensure collaborative thrivability between biodiversity conservation, social justice and economic empowerment.
